Blood Types Around the World
Blood types are one of the most critical biological traits that individuals carry. While O+ is the most common blood type worldwide, less common types like AB- are extremely rare, making every blood donation invaluable. The distribution of these types varies widely across countries, ethnicities, and population groups due to genetic and ancestral factors. This diversity is essential for maintaining adequate blood supplies, particularly in emergency medicine, surgeries, transfusions, and disaster response situations.

The Global Distribution of Blood Types
Globally, here’s how blood types are distributed:
- O+: 37%
- A+: 27%
- B+: 8%
- AB+: 3%
- O-: 6%
- A-: 4%
- B-: 2%
- AB-: 1%
These percentages represent the estimated global distribution in the general population. However, it’s important to note that these figures can vary significantly based on ethnicity, geography, and specific population groups.
Regional Variations
Different regions around the world exhibit unique blood type distributions. For instance, in Europe, blood types A and O are more common, while in Asia, B and O types are more prevalent. In countries like China and Japan, the B+ blood type is more frequently found, whereas in Scandinavian countries, the A+ blood type is more common. These regional differences underscore the importance of diverse blood supplies.

The Impact of Blood Type on Health
Blood type is more than just a label; it can influence health outcomes and susceptibility to certain diseases. For example, studies have shown that individuals with type O blood may have a lower risk of heart disease but a higher risk of ulcers. Conversely, those with type A blood may have a lower risk of heart disease but a higher risk of stomach cancer. Understanding these correlations can help in early detection and prevention of diseases.
The Role of Blood Types in Medical Procedures
Knowing your blood type is crucial for various medical procedures. In emergency situations, such as during a car accident or natural disaster, having the right blood type on hand can save lives. Similarly, during surgeries, transfusions, and organ transplants, matching blood types is essential to avoid complications.

Blood type distribution varies due to genetic and ancestral factors. Different populations have evolved with distinct blood type frequencies, influenced by historical migrations, genetic drift, and natural selection. For instance, blood type B is more common in Asia, while type A is prevalent in Europe.
